Massive Fire in Flat at Dattani Tower in Borivali, No Injuries Reported

A massive fire broke out at a 12-storey residential building in Borivali West, Mumbai, on Friday afternoon, creating panic among residents but causing no casualties.
The blaze erupted around 2:18 pm at Dattani Tower, located on Kora Kendra Road. According to officials, the fire started in a flat on the seventh floor and quickly spread to parts of the eighth. Flames and thick smoke were seen coming out of the building, with videos of the incident circulating on social media.
The Mumbai Fire Brigade rushed to the spot along with local rescue teams and began evacuation. The fire was largely confined to household items, electric wiring, wooden furniture, and an air-conditioning unit in a 1,200 sq. ft. apartment.
Thick smoke billowing from the affected floors caused panic, but fortunately, no injuries or casualties were reported. Firefighting operations are underway, and the exact cause of the blaze is yet to be determined.
